refused ppi by santander

Santander have advised the ppi was taken out in 2002 and we had only 15 years to make a mis-selling complaint and more than 15 years have passed so they have determined it is time-barred is this correct please

    It depends on the type of PPI it was and Santander's relationship at the time.

    If it was a branch based product (such as credit card PPI, loan PPI etc) then no, the 15 year rule does not apply. However, Santander have liability for some store cards and with certain pre 2005 sales, the 15 year rule can apply.
